The Italian pilot based in Maresme Tony Arbolino He inaugurated his record of victories in his second season in Moto2 in a survival race in Austin whose wind and mistakes were compromised, causing injury in the form of a crash when they were ahead of the first and second classifieds. at the World Championship, Celestino Vietti and Arón Canet, who followed up by 21 points. Arbolino added his fourth win that put him third in the World Cup 16 points ahead of Ai Ogura who finished second with 14 points by Vietti, and Dixon, first podium at 26 years old.
From pole position, Cameron Beaubier, a five -time MotoAmerica Superbike winner, remained ahead of Vietti and Arbolino beat Canet inside. But the leadership of the race took a few corners for the American before Vietti, the World Championship leader, took over. The misfortune for the American came in four corners from the end of the race when he crashed while heading into the fourth.
The first lap was chaotic for the drivers in the middle of the group involved in several incidents, the first lap in turn 1 where Augusto Fernández, Fermín Aldeguer and Albert Arenas were involved and went to the tail of the group. And before the end of the first lap, another braking incident of 12 courtesy of a very late Chantra where Lowes took the lead and Aldeguer himself received again and the race ended in the first lap with some of the favorites.
In front Vietti called for a breakaway and Arón Canet was too attentive and got hooked on him and on the third lap the Valencian noticed the Italian and began to impose his speed. Acosta, who was absent in all the incidents of the first lap, was riding in fifth position when going through turn 3 in the fourth lap he went down alone in a very dangerous spot and luckily Ogura was fine.
And in pursuit of Canet in the fifth lap Celestino Vietti fell in turn 6 leaving Arón as the virtual leader by 4 points, but it was time to end a race that was a survival race. He already has Arbolino 1 “3 and Dixon 1” 7 as his main opponents with 13 laps left.
And after three laps, with 1 “7 at Arbolino, Canet fell on turn 7. There was no way to inaugurate Moto2 victories for the man from Flexbox Pons, even on a circuit where in 2019 he covered one of his six wins in Moto3.
After serious warnings to sailors with falls in the first and second of the World Championship, pilot Marc VDS took the lead with 1 “1 to Dixon and 2” 5 to Ogura cementing the podium. There was a switch for second with seven more laps when Dixon expanded and Ogura passed him and then easily released. At the front Arbolino kept 3 “and they continued like this until the finish line.
As for the Spaniards, Jorge Navarro is fifth, rookie Jeremy Alcoba is sixth, Augusto Fernández is ninth, Albert Arenas is eleventh, Marcos Ramírez is twelfth, Manu González is th -13 and Arón Canet, Pedro Acosta and Fermín Aldeguer fell.
